About the role:

As Event Marketing Manager, you’ll own the strategy, planning, and flawless execution of all field-marketing events that put the company in front of the right prospects and customers—trade shows, executive dinners, roadshows, and product-launch experiences. You’ll collaborate cross-functionally with Sales, Product Marketing, and Customer Success to turn each event into a measurable pipeline and revenue.

Key Responsibilities:

Event Strategy & Planning

  • Define the annual event calendar aligned to revenue targets and buyer personas.
  • Select the right mix of industry conferences, regional roadshows, partner events, and bespoke experiences.
  • Build event briefs with positioning, goals, target accounts, and success metrics.

Execution & Logistics

  • Own end-to-end project management: venue/vendor sourcing, contract negotiation, run-of-show, staffing, shipping, and on-site oversight.
  • Ensure brand consistency across booth design, signage, swag, and digital assets.
  • Manage budgets, timelines, and post-event reconciliations.

Cross-Functional Alignment

  • Partner with Product Marketing to craft compelling narratives and demos.
  • Work with Sales to drive pre-show outreach, on-site meetings, and post-show follow-up cadences.
  • Coordinate with Customer Success to secure client speakers and success stories.
  • Work with social media manager to promote the brand presence.

Measurement & Optimization

  • Set KPIs (MQLs, SALs, pipeline, influenced revenue) and track performance in Salesforce and marketing-automation platforms.
  • Analyze results, surface insights, and continually refine event mix and tactics for higher ROI.

Relationship Building

  • Cultivate relationships with industry associations, vendors, media, and partners—especially within the banking and credit-union ecosystem.
  • Negotiate premium placement, speaking slots, and co-marketing opportunities.

What You Bring:

  • 5+ years of field or event-marketing experience in a B2B SaaS environment.
  • Financial-services focus: demonstrable success running conferences and regional events targeting banks or credit unions (or adjacent fintech audiences) a plus.
  • Mastery of event tech stack—e.g., HubSpot, Salesforce—and proficiency with virtual/hybrid event formats.
  • Proven track record of translating events into pipeline and revenue; data-driven mindset with comfort presenting metrics to executives.
  • Stellar vendor-management and negotiation skills; ability to manage multiple projects and budgets concurrently.
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ills; polished on-stage presence a plus.
  • Willingness to travel ≈ 25 % (peaks around major conferences).

Nice-to-Have:

  • Existing network within credit-union associations (e.g., CUNA, NAFCU) and key trade-show organizers.
  • Experience coordinating user conferences or product-launch roadshows.
  • Familiarity with webinar production and podcast/live-stream formats.

Compensation

Total compensation is expected to be between $100,000–$130,000, including a performance-based component. Actual compensation may vary depending on experience and location.
